Mr. Douglas drove 2,482 miles. He spent 42.5 hours in the car driving. What was his average speed for the trip?
riadik2000 [5.3K]

I think you just divide the number of miles by the number of hours he spent driving.

2,482/42.5= 58.4

58mph

What is the volume of the prism
Scilla [17]
Hey there :)

We know the volume formula of triangular prism
Volume = base x height of prism
             = \frac{1}{2} (base)(height)(height of prism)

We are given:
The base = 8 in
The height = 15 in
You do not need the 17 in ( it is there to trick you )
The height of the prism = 10 in

Apply the formula,
V = \frac{1}{2} (8)(15)(10)
   = 600 in³

Your final answer will be the last option
